CenTex Beef Cattle Symposium

  The CenTex Beef Cattle Program is an annual nine-county educational program that rotates each year to a site within one of the host counties. The Beef and Forage Committees within these counties are dedicated in identifying issues and needs that will economically benefit cattle and forage production in Central Texas.

CenTex Beef Symposium Set for September 24th The theme for the Annual CenTex Beef Symposium is “The Business End of The Cattle Business”.  This annual event is sponsored by 9 area counties in Central Texas and will be held Friday, September 24th at the Texas A&M McGregor Research Center, 773 Ag Farm Road, McGregor, Texas. Registration begins at 7:30 a.m. and the programs start at 8:30 a.m. with Dr. Don Gill, Extension Beef Cattle Specialist discussing “Factors Affecting Profitability and Key Performance Indicators” in the beef herd.
